Neil Kakkar 使用 unittest.patch() 探索选项,然后使用“with connection.execute_wrapper(QueryTimeoutWrapper()):”确定一个更简洁的模式来模拟他需要测试的确切异常。
通过龙虾
原文: http://simonwillison.net/2023/Jan/15/simulate-broken-db/#atom-everything
翻译英文优质信息和名人推特
Neil Kakkar 使用 unittest.patch() 探索选项,然后使用“with connection.execute_wrapper(QueryTimeoutWrapper()):”确定一个更简洁的模式来模拟他需要测试的确切异常。
通过龙虾
原文: http://simonwillison.net/2023/Jan/15/simulate-broken-db/#atom-everything